The Significance of the 98% RTP
The 98% Return to Player (RTP) rate is a significant feature of the chicken road crossing game. This statistic indicates the average percentage of wagered money that the game will return to players over an extended period. A 98% RTP is exceptionally high compared to many other games, suggesting a fair and rewarding experience for players. While RTP doesn’t guarantee individual wins, it demonstrates that the game is designed to be profitable for players over the long run. Such a transparency builds trust and enhances the players’ enjoyment.
This high RTP sets it apart from many other casual games of chance, and is a primary draw for players seeking genuine value. The RTP is calculated over millions of game plays; individual results can vary significantly due to the inherent randomness of the game. However, the high RTP indicates that the game is not biased against players and offers a reasonable chance of success.
